This goes back to one of those old-school UNIX arguments about what "local" was supposed to be. I am sure that I don't care... but for clarity I have always kept my linux machines (and now my mac) with most apps in /usr - You will notice that various "flavors" of linux will vary on this too. Red Hat/Fedora (which is what I used for years) was always a non "local" distro.
